The Royal Touch (2014) follows Salvage (2008). In both works a simple circuit of my design reanimates a dead circuit board to create a chaotic multi-voice oscillator. Salvage uses six players (usually drafted from hacking workshops) and a conductor (me.) The Royal Touch is a solo. Fishing weights make nudgeable contacts between my circuit in the Simon Lévelt tea box and the dead board.
